The following set of patches were tested on an i.MX6 multi-core platform.

Patches 1 to 4 were tested using a Bluetooth BCSP UART connection at 115.2kbps
and 4Mbps. The fixes were needed because the i.MX6 UART driver caused spinlock
deadlocks with the HCI TTY layer.

Patch 5 improves the i.MX6 UART driver for use with kdb.

Patch 1: serial: imx: remove unneeded imx_transmit_buffer() from imx_start_tx()
Patch 2: serial: imx: remove uart_write_wakeup() from imx_transmit_buffer()
Patch 3: serial: imx: avoid spinlock recursion deadlock
Patch 4: serial: imx: move imx_transmit_buffer() into imx_txint()
Patch 5: serial: imx: clean up imx_poll_get_char()

The patches are based off 3.15-rc4.

Given the rather confusing threads based on these patches, I don't know
what to apply.

Dean, can you respin what patches you want applied
Well, we think patches #1-#4 are correct and should be applied, but 
Huang has the opinion that this is fixed already in the BT stack. If 
Huang doesn't change his mind, then let's drop #1-#4.

Patch #5 addresses an other topic and therefore should be resent, then.
